I think the reason for what Richard was experiencing is a new option in International Prefs...at the bottom of the Input Menu tab, there is now an "Allow a different input source for each document." option, which might cause the layout to change by virtue of switching between apps or docs.

Place your cursor over any word and press apple-ctrl-d.

It reveals a dictionary definition of the word.
But apparently only in certain apps. Doesn't work in Firefox, for example. Or textmate.

I am pretty sure that the distinction is Cocoa or not, isn't it? Just like in Panther, how Cocoa apps support inline spell-checking using the system checker but Carbon ones do not?
